[HTML][HTML] Arterial cardiovascular events, statins, low-dose aspirin and subsequent risk of venous thromboembolism: a population-based case-control study

HT Sørensen, E Horvath-Puho, KK Søgaard… - Journal of thrombosis …, 2009 - Elsevier
Background: Atherosclerotic disease has been associated with the risk of venous
thromboembolism, but the available data are conflicting. There are similar confusions
regarding the association of the use of aspirin and statins with venous thromboembolism.
Objectives: To determine whether arterial cardiovascular events, use of statins and low-dose
aspirin were associated with the risk of venous thromboembolism. Patients and methods: In
this population-based case–control study, we identified 5824 patients with venous …
